Well to start I bought an 06 LBZ crewcab with 111 miles. The first add on was the Edge Juice w attitude followed by an AFE turbo back 4" system. The first problem I ran into was when I would pull away from a stoplight and inbetween 2nd and 3rd gear the transmission would slip out of gear and the rpms would fall off to almost nothing. Just as soon as you lift your foot off the gas and reapply pressure everything would work as it should. After sending my chip back 2 times and then recieving a brand new chip, wire harness, pyrometer, and a new controller for the third and last try. While towing a 26' boat and merging onto I-95 around 45 mph the transmission unlocked while merging and then SLAMMED back into gear causing the whole truck to jump. I pulled over and unhooked the chip and plugged everything up in stock configuration. No more problems after this.
Next, I have a 4x4 buggy that I tow on a car hauler 16', estimated weight @ 6,000lbs combined. Every time I take a trip towing this sometime during the trip my check engine light comes on with the same code (EGR valve).
The truck has been to the dealership 12 times due to this problem. The mechanic at the dealership says, "The egr valve is working properly and there is nothing wrong that he can find. The only thing that could cause the code to come up is the aftermarket exhaust pipe, not allowing enough backpressure." I can take the exhaust off and put my stock exhaust back on, or I can drive around with my CHECK ENGINGE light on in my 06 truck.
I know there are some people out there that have built this truck sucessfully alot further than I was looking to go. Any help, comments, or ideas would greatly be appriciated.
So I gather you have a cat delete pipe on? If so, your cheapest fix would be to get an egr blocker and fingerstick from http://www.kennedydiesel.com/detail.cfm?ID=451 . As far as the other stuff, the tranny sounds like it needs to be reflashed at the dealer. I take it that once you took the edge off it shifts fine?

well the truck back to the dealer and have them upgrade the computer on the Allison and then sell the edge and buy the PPE Standard tuner and out it on the 2nd setting and the PPE disables the EGR so you wont get the P0401 or the P0403(i think there might be a P0404 also)codes after that install the EGR block plate to keep the soot ot of the EGR..

As soon as I took the Edge chip off the trans shifted fine and the only problem that remained was the once a month check engine light.
Does the PPE system have any sort of display or do you have to run gauges? The only part of the Edge system I liked was the display screen to monitor egt, turbo, etc. Thanks for the info.
no the PPE doesn't have the Display screen but i would invest into a set of Boost"n"Egt's gauges and you'llbe fine..

If you want digital displays...there are other options too...EDGE makes an outlook monitor that just monitors your truck...No tune.....Bully Dog makes a PMT that monitors and tunes....and Banks also makes a system that has digital displays as well. But if you could really care less between digital and guages....put a dual or triple pillar pod in your truck...they look nice. The cheapest Boost/EGT with pillar combo I could find was 275.00 for the parts from DieselNutMotorsports. He's a member on here.
